Webbird flu - bird using tool stock illustrations image of gardener hand pruning plant in raised vegetable beds on residential balcony, ghaziabad, india, designed with artificial grass turf … WebMar 31, 2024 · First, a bird needs to learn that an object can be used to solve a problem. Second, it must have the working memory to deal with the procedural complexity involved in tool use. Third, it must acquire the motor skills to manipulate a tool in a controlled way.
